About This Tool
This tool accepts viscosity in centipoise (cP) and liquid density in g/cm3 to compute the kinematic viscosity in centistokes (cSt). The core relationship is ν = μ / ρ, where μ is dynamic viscosity and ρ is density. Conceptually, dynamic viscosity reflects resistance to shear, while kinematic viscosity incorporates fluid motion through density.
